
Main Street Family Compound

This project’s goal was simple:
Develop the rear yard to accommodate a laneway house that would easily house the younger generation and their growing family, while maintaining the character of the principal dwelling.


This cozy laneway house fits right into its surroundings, effortlessly finding a sense of place within the neighbourhood.



A harmonious addition.
This home was designed parallel the beautifully preserved 1921 Craftsman-style heritage house. Inside, every detail was thoughtfully planned to capture the soft, year-round light that pours in from the south and east over Mount Pleasant.

The final box that needed to be checked was ensuring the home could comfortably accommodate an older generation in the future. Should the young family outgrow the cozy two-bedroom cottage, the single-level layout provides an accessible and practical solution for aging in place.
While there's no immediate need for an "age in place" solution, this thoughtfully designed, accessible home is ready and waiting—just in case the need arises in the future.

This project is a great example of how a laneway house can seamlessly blend with an existing property, enhancing both functionality and aesthetic appeal.
